Broken Bow vs. Cozad to be Broadcast on KBBN

Broken Bow will host Cozad for a girls and boys basketball doubleheader Friday night at the Indian gym. The girls game is scheduled to tip off at 6pm with the boys game to follow. The games will be broadcast live on KBBN 95.3 FM and on kbbn.com. It will also be hall of fame night as Broken Bow graduate Nathan Scott will be inducted into the Broken Bow Athletic Hall of Fame. The induction will take place following the conclusion of the Broken Bow / Cozad boys game with a reception for Scott to follow.
